Output 8d5630b9f108296156f3365feeee00cc2ebe55fab4d473f3d04f1c92f07da967:513

value
1459080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1348a3d6f903392e5fb52749b0e84827859645b OP_EQUAL
address
DRfsWxqPjHpW8at9LPkBzptREikhPZvpbc
transaction
8d5630b9f108296156f3365feeee00cc2ebe55fab4d473f3d04f1c92f07da967
spent
true